Channel your best British-isms and head to Martyn George for its “Holiday Party with an English Accent” on Saturday from 4 p.m. to 8 p.m. The owner, Johanna Brannan Lowe, is an Anglo expat and wanted to throw a soirée that reminded her of home. So there will be royal pies from Pleasant House Bakery (which are out-of-control good), mulled wine, and traditional English Christmas crackers with cards inside that offer discounts at the store. Oh, and while you’re there, you can browse the awesome vintage gifts there (’60s-era etched glass barware, English cake stands, painted platters, etc.). Brilliant!
